Which is Better: Mealworms or Superworms for Your Pet or Bait?

When it comes to feeding reptiles or preparing for a successful fishing trip, mealworms and superworms are two of the most popular choices. Both are high in protein and easy to store, but they have unique differences that make them better suited for different purposes. If you’ve been wondering which one is right for your pet or fishing needs, let’s break down the key differences and benefits of mealworms and superworms.

Mealworms: The Nutritional All-Star for Smaller Pets
Mealworms are the larvae of the darkling beetle and are known for their high protein and fat content. They are smaller in size, making them an excellent food source for small reptiles, amphibians, and even birds.

Benefits of Mealworms:

  • High in protein and fat, perfect for growth and energy.
  • Easy to digest for smaller reptiles like geckos, frogs, and young bearded dragons.
  • Affordable and easy to store — they can be kept in the fridge to extend their lifespan.
  • Great for birds and other small animals that need a quick energy boost.

Best Use:

Ideal for feeding geckos, chameleons, frogs, small birds, and smaller fish.
Excellent for bait when fishing for smaller fish species.
Superworms: The Big, Crunchy Treat
Superworms are the larvae of the Zophobas morio beetle and are significantly larger than mealworms. They have a tougher exoskeleton, which makes them a bit harder to digest but more satisfying for larger reptiles and pets.

Benefits of Superworms:

  • Larger size makes them more appealing to bigger reptiles and pets.
  • High in protein and fat, which supports healthy growth and weight gain.
  • More active — the movement stimulates the hunting instinct in reptiles.
  • A great source of enrichment since their wriggling action keeps pets engaged.

Best Use:

Perfect for feeding larger reptiles like adult bearded dragons, monitors, and leopard geckos.
Highly effective for catching larger freshwater fish due to their size and movement.

Which One is Right for You?
If you have a smaller reptile or need a versatile bait option, mealworms are your best bet. But if you’re feeding a larger pet or want to attract big fish, superworms are the way to go. Many reptile owners choose to keep both on hand to provide variety and balance in their pet’s diet.
